432MHz AFS 2010



This year saw a big step up in participation, with sixty-three entries (last year there were thirty-five). A total of twenty-six affiliated society teams appear in the results - twelve more than last year.

Bolton Wireless Club managed to get eleven of their members on air, which resulted in the first `D' team on record!

Conditions were generally described as flat or poor, but activity was noted as good compared to previous years.

Congratulations to Chesham & District Amateur Radio Society, who win for the fifth consecutive year. They retain the G0ODQ trophy. Spalding & District Amateur Radio Society came second, as they did in 2009, but managed to narrow the gap with the leaders this year.

Congratulations to Keith Tatnall G4ODA for winning the Single Operator Fixed section for the third year running. Pete Lindsay G4CLA was in second place.

There was a close battle at the top of the Open section, with Dave Gilligan G1OGY/P coming out just ahead after adjudication with an error-free log. David and Pete Millard, operating as M0GHZ, were a very close second.

The following also receive certificates:

  • Mick Toms M6XBF - leading foundation licensee SF Section
  • Bob Treacher 2E0RCV - leading intermediate licensee SF Section
  • Jonathon 2E0CNJ/P - leading intermediate licensee Open Section
  • Richard Staples G4HGI - leading fixed station running 25W or less to a single antenna

Checklogs gratefully received from G3VCQ, G8AQO/P, G8ONK, and PE1EWR.

Bob Edgar G0KYS
